Description

Rare North Monrovia architectural time capsule blending the romance of a 1920s Spanish Revival residence with a detached studio house inspired by California’s indoor-outdoor lifestyle tradition. Set near historic landmarks, scenic foothill trails, wilderness preserve areas, and Old Town Monrovia, this largely untouched property offers a rare opportunity to restore and preserve a timeless architectural gem rich with original character and craftsmanship. Classic details include a red clay tile roof, covered corridor with exposed wood-beam ceilings, graceful arches, handcrafted moldings, decorative attic vents, textured plaster walls, hardwood flooring, handcrafted light fixtures, authentic hand-wrought ironwork, and an arched wooden front door with wrought iron detailing and original mail slot. A Batchelder fireplace serves as a stunning focal point reflecting the artistry of its era. Mature olive and avocado trees, lush landscaping, shaded walkways, and a private courtyard create a peaceful old California compound atmosphere between the primary residence, detached outdoor living studio, and garage. The detached studio offers approx 450 sq. ft. with vaulted wood-beam ceilings, expansive windows, rustic wood-paneled walls, a dramatic brick fireplace, and vintage wood-burning grill with ventilation hood. Flexible potential for studio, office, gym, lounge, workshop, game room, or guest retreat. Studio house includes a currently non-functioning bathroom vintage sink and toilet. The primary residence offers 3 bedrooms and 1 bathroom. Desirable features include an eat-in kitchen, as well as an easy-access basement. A detached two-car garage with built-in workbench provides additional parking, storage, and workshop space. Convenient access to Los Angeles and neighboring communities including Sierra Madre, Pasadena, and Arcadia. Monrovia is recognized as a two-time All-America City Award recipient known for its strong sense of community and historic charm. A rare opportunity for a buyer who appreciates restoration, original architectural integrity, timeless craftsmanship, and the enduring character of an authentic Spanish Revival home.
